The core argument centers on the shift from AI as a discrete task performer to AI as a dynamic, goal-oriented collaborator. For a logistics startup in New York, understanding this framework means moving past simple route optimization to agents that can dynamically renegotiate shipping contracts, adjust fleet deployment based on real-time weather and traffic, and even manage customer service inquiries related to delivery changes, all while adhering to predefined budget and service level agreements. An internal IT team at a mid-size financial services firm in Chicago could leverage this by developing agents that automate compliance checks, flag suspicious transactions by cross-referencing multiple data sources, and triage critical security alerts, thereby freeing up human analysts for more strategic decision-making. Even a freelance designer in Portland, Oregon, could capitalize on this by employing an agent to manage client communications, schedule feedback sessions, track project timelines, and even autonomously generate initial design concepts based on a brief, integrating seamlessly with their existing suite of creative tools. To begin exploring this, consider one small, repetitive, multi-step process within your own work or organization that currently consumes significant human time and involves data from at least two different systems. Map out the exact steps, decisions, and data inputs involved. Then, using open-source agentic frameworks or even basic scripting languages, experiment with building a rudimentary agent that can automate the first two steps of that process. Focus on defining clear objectives and access parameters, even if the initial output requires human oversight.
